鱼C论坛

 找回密码
 立即注册
查看: 4752|回复: 17

这是那里出错了 求教

[复制链接]
发表于 2013-11-27 12:35:43 | 显示全部楼层
你的s是int型的,pi是float型的,
两种数据类型的值在做运算时,一般是是低精度的像高精度的赋值,最好不要反过来。
例如:
       float a = 1;      正确
       int    a = 1.0;   虽然能通过,但提示说会损失精度(是warning,可以编译连接通过 )
然后就是计算圆面积的公式应该写成:s = r*r *PI;
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2025-9-22 18:28

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表